Ingredients
½ cup raw pumpkin seeds pepitas
¼ cup chia seeds
¼ cup ground flaxseed
2 tsp lemon zest
1 tsp Ceylon Cinnamon true cinnamon
1 pinch sea salt
Instructions
How To Make Bariatric Seed Trick Recipe
Toast pumpkin seeds in a dry skillet over medium heat, stirring, 4–5 min until they pop.
½ cup raw pumpkin seeds
Cool + Mix: Tip seeds into a bowl, let cool 2 min. Stir in chia, flax, lemon zest, cinnamon, and salt.
¼ cup chia seeds,¼ cup ground flaxseed,2 tsp lemon zest,1 tsp Ceylon Cinnamon,1 pinch sea salt
Grind All of these together till fine powder.
Store in an airtight jar up to 3 weeks.
How to use the mix (the Bariatric Seed ritual)
In The Morning: Stir 1 Tbsp bariatric seed mix into 250 ml warm water with a squeeze of lemon; wait 3 min for the chia to gel, then drink/chew
Bariatric Seed Drink Recipe
Mix together 1 Tbsp Bariatric seed mix you made above into 1cup (8oz) warm water. Add in 1 tsp fresh ginger grated, steep 3 min, stir in 1 tsp fresh lemon juice , sip slowly.

Step-by-Step Bariatric Seed Trick Recipe
Toasting, Grinding & Storing: A Complete Guide
Making your own bariatric seed trick blend is surprisingly simple and requires no special equipment beyond a skillet and a spice grinder or blender. Here’s how to do it right:
Ingredients You’ll Need
- ½ cup raw pumpkin seeds (pepitas)
- ¼ cup chia seeds
- ¼ cup ground flaxseed
- 2 teaspoons lemon zest (preferably organic)
- 1 teaspoon Ceylon cinnamon (true cinnamon)
- 1 pinch sea salt
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Toast Pumpkin Seeds
Heat a dry skillet over medium heat. Add the pumpkin seeds and stir constantly for about 4 to 5 minutes. They’re ready when they start to pop and smell nutty. This enhances flavor and digestibility. - Cool and Combine
Transfer the toasted seeds to a bowl. Let them cool for at least 2 minutes. Then stir in chia seeds, ground flaxseed, lemon zest, Ceylon cinnamon, and a pinch of sea salt. - Grind to Fine Powder
Using a spice grinder, blender, or food processor, pulse the mixture until it becomes a fine powder. You can leave a bit of texture if you prefer more chew. - Store Properly
Place the finished mix in an airtight glass jar or sealed container. Store in a cool, dry place ideally your pantry. This blend will stay fresh and potent for up to 3 weeks.
Storage Tips: Keeping Your Mix Fresh for Weeks
- Avoid Moisture: Even small amounts of moisture can cause chia seeds to swell and spoil the mix. Always use a dry spoon when scooping.
- Keep It Cool: Heat and sunlight can degrade flaxseed oils. Store in a shaded, cool cabinet.
- Regrind in Small Batches: If you’re making a large batch, keep half unground until you’re ready to use it. Ground flax and chia lose potency quickly.

Potential Side Effects and Safety Notes
Who Should Avoid the Bariatric Seed Ritual
Although the bariatric seed trick is made from natural, nutrient-dense ingredients, it’s not for everyone. Certain individuals may need to proceed with caution—or avoid it altogether.
Avoid or Consult a Doctor If You:
- Have seed allergies (e.g., pumpkin, flax, chia)
- Are on blood thinners or blood pressure meds (flaxseed and cinnamon may interact)
- Have a sensitive digestive system or IBS (the fiber load can cause bloating if not introduced gradually)
- Are pregnant or breastfeeding (consult with your OB/GYN due to hormone-impacting ingredients like flaxseed)
People with underlying health issues or metabolic conditions should always consult a healthcare provider before adding new remedies especially ones that affect digestion, hormones, or blood sugar.
Interactions with Medications or Diet Plans
Many assume “natural” means “risk-free,” but even clean ingredients can interact with medications or diet protocols.
Possible Interactions:
- Chia seeds + blood pressure meds: May lower BP further
- Flaxseed + diabetes meds: May enhance the effects of insulin or other glucose-lowering agents
- Cinnamon + blood thinners: Could increase the risk of bleeding
Additionally, those on low-FODMAP or elimination diets might want to introduce flax and chia slowly, monitoring for bloating, cramping, or loose stools.
Tips for a Safe Start:
- Begin with ½ tablespoon daily instead of 1 full tablespoon
- Mix with extra water to ease digestion
- Monitor bowel movements and energy levels
The body may need 3–5 days to adjust to the high fiber content. Give yourself time to adapt—this isn’t a race, it’s a wellness upgrade.
